What Exactly Is a Sintering Titanium Filter Sheet?
Simply put, a sintering titanium filter sheet is a porous, metallic filter made by heating titanium particles just enough so they bond without melting, creating a mesh-like structure. The pore sizes can be controlled precisely during production to allow specific particles—like sediments, bacteria, or chemical residues—to be trapped while letting fluids pass through smoothly.
This filter technology bridges advanced metallurgy and industrial filtration, especially where plastic or ceramic filters would fail either through fragility or chemical incompatibility. It matters in industries where purity and longevity are critical, or where filter replacement is costly or dangerous.
Key Features of Sintering Titanium Filter Sheets
1. Durability
Unlike polymer filters that degrade or ceramics prone to cracking, sintering titanium filter sheets endure tough environments. For example, their resistance to corrosive acids or extreme heat makes them indispensable in chemical manufacturing. The sheets can last years under constant use.
2. Precise Filtration Control
Because the pore sizes can be engineered finely, these sheets suit applications requiring microfiltration or even ultrafiltration standards. The uniform pore structure means notably consistent performance batch after batch.
3. Scalability & Customization
Producers can fabricate filter sheets in various sizes and thicknesses optimizing for flow rate or filtration grade, from small lab-scale filters to industrial panels. This adaptability is crucial when technologies are deployed in vastly different settings.
4. Cost Efficiency Over Time
While titanium filters might seem pricier upfront, their longevity and minimal maintenance often translate into cost savings, especially when downtime or filter replacement costs are factored in.
Specifications of a Typical Sintering Titanium Filter Sheet
| Parameter | Typical Value | Units |
|---|---|---|
| Material Grade | Grade 1-4 Titanium | - |
| Pore Size Range | 0.2 - 50 | Micrometers (µm) |
| Thickness | 0.3 - 3.0 | mm |
| Operating Temperature | Up to 600 | °C |
| Operating Pressure | Up to 10 | MPa |
Mini takeaway: These technical details underscore why sintering titanium filter sheets excel in harsh industrial environments — from petrochemical refineries to pharmaceutical production.
Global Applications & Use Cases
- Water Treatment: In disaster-stricken areas lacking clean water, humanitarian organizations employ durable filters made from sintered titanium sheets to provide safe drinking water quickly. The sheets’ corrosion resistance means they handle a broad array of contaminants.
- Oil and Gas Industry: Separating fine particles from liquids and gases requires robust filters. In Middle East petrochemical plants, sintering titanium filter sheets survive acidic, high-temperature pipelines that would damage other filters.
- Electronics Manufacturing: Ultra-pure water and chemicals are vital for semiconductor fabrication. Manufacturers in South Korea utilize sintered titanium filters to maintain contamination-free processes.
Oddly enough, even spacecraft component manufacturing employs these sheets to filter chemical additives during production — a testament to their precision and reliability in extreme contexts.

Challenges & Expert Solutions
Frankly, sintered titanium filter sheets aren’t without challenges. Their production can be energy-intensive, and initial costs may deter smaller operations. However, advances in additive manufacturing and automation are reducing these barriers, making customization faster and more affordable.
Also, engineers recommend pairing titanium filters with pre-filtration systems to extend their service life when dealing with heavily contaminated sources. This practical pairing often yields the best overall system performance.
F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ions About Sintering Titanium Filter Sheet
- Q: How does sintering titanium filter sheet compare to ceramic filters?
- A: Titanium filters generally offer better corrosion resistance and mechanical strength, making them preferable in harsh chemical or industrial environments, whereas ceramic filters might be more fragile but lower in upfront cost.
- Q: Can these filter sheets be cleaned and reused?
- A: Yes, one of the benefits is their durability allows repeated cleaning cycles, often through ultrasonic or chemical methods, extending lifespan and reducing waste.
- Q: Are sintering titanium filters suitable for potable water systems?
- A: Absolutely. Their inertness and tight pore control make them ideal for removing bacteria and particulates in drinking water purification, highly favored in both municipal and disaster relief systems.
- Q: What customization options are typically available?
- A: Pore sizes, thickness, panel dimensions, and titanium grade can often be customized to suit specific industries or filtration requirements.
